"Zoutvat, fragment" is a collection of pewter salt cellars, dating back to the late 16th century. The small, detailed pieces, now part of the Rijksmuseum collection, are a testament to the craftsmanship and artistry of anonymous artisans from the Dutch Golden Age. The salt cellars, designed to be placed on a table for communal use, feature delicate forms and intricate details. They serve as a reminder of the importance of salt as a condiment and a symbol of hospitality during this period. The collection of salt cellars, known as "Zoutvat, fragment," showcases the artistry and functionality of everyday objects during a pivotal moment in Dutch history.
